Andrew Jensdotter’s paintings and drawings depict the visual static of collective imagery. Mining the glossy pages of magazines and online search queries, the artist transforms sets of related photographic content into physical layers of representational paintings on a single surface. This transfer from dematerialized imagery into physical layers of stacked paint serves as a means to a larger end. Upon building up numerous rendered layers onto a single canvas, the artist eviscerates the thick surface revealing a highly energetic composite made from a chosen subject matter’s accumulated color palette. Where once the eye had a specific subject to focus on, what remains is an all-over composition devoid of any focal point, forcing the eye to either race across its surface or relax into a psychedelic trance. The relationship between additive and subtractive processes, and the disintegration of the specific into the abstract, presents a visual analog for the nature of processing information in the age of mass media. Andrew Jensdotter is a visual artist based in Denver, Colorado. He received his MFA in painting and drawing from the University of Colorado Boulder in 2014. Andrew’s work has been shown in both group and solo exhibitions internationally including Zonamaco with Galeria Hilario Galguera, Untitled in Miami in 2016 – 2018 and 2021, Jackson Hole Fine Art Fair 2019, and PULSE Miami December 2019. Andrew recently had a solo show at the Museum of Contemporary Art in Denver, titled “Flak.” Andrew’s work is featured in prominent collections throughout the USA and abroad, including a recent acquisition by the Denver Art Museum. Jensdotter received a visiting artist fellowship at Anderson Ranch in Snowmass, Colorado in February 2020. In the Spring of 2021, Andrew had a solo show at K Contemporary gallery in Denver, CO.

From his recent exhibition entitled, Dioramas from Eden, Andrew Jensdotter continues his practice of painting hundreds of layers of iconic pictures of a single subject from a Google image search and then carving through the final amalgamation to create an "original" of his own. What was once representational with a clear focal point becomes a decidedly all-over abstract composition almost archaeological in nature. Eduardo Costa is one of the key figures in global conceptual art. He was born in Buenos Aires in 1940. He graduated in Literature and Art at the University of Buenos Aires in 1965 where he took courses with Jorge Luis Borges in the late fifties. His practice developed into Conceptual POP with the Fashion Fictions Series, 1966-to the present. He is also credited with creating Conceptual Geometry which he showed internationally starting in 1995 at the Elga Wimmer Gallery, NY, and in 2001 at Cecilia de Torres LTD., NY.
